About the Book

The book describes various principles and practices involved in processing and utilization of agricultural and livestock's produces for food, feed and other uses. It gives details of sequences starting from harvesting at an optimum stage of physiological maturity till its processing and utilization, including that of crop residues, wastes and processing by- products from field crops and horticultural & livestock produces. Various unit operations have been described in details. Processing and utilization of grains (cereals, pulses and oilseeds), horticultural crops (fruits, vegetables, flowers), livestock produces (milk, meat, chicken, egg and fishes); spices & condiments; aromatic & medicinal plants; miscellaneous crops (fibre, resins & gums, tea, coffee, cocoa, opium) have been covered. A chapter on sustainable agriculture for food and nutritional security of the ever growing Indian & Global population under the dwindling land & water resources and another one on food metabolism and diet design, for the benefits of the readers have been included. A glossary of various terms & terminology used in agricultural and livestock produce processing has been given. In all, there are 13 chapters and five appendices giving some relevant and useful information on processing and utilization of harvested biomass of plant & animal origin. Some useful tips on as to how to become a fit and relaxed person for a better living, health, happiness and longevity have been added in the appendix. A subject index has also been given at the end of the book. It is written and presented in a way so that it can serve as a text and/or a reference book, too. About the Author :
Dr. Nawab Ali, born on 1st January, 1947, has had his last appointment as Deputy Director General (Engg.), Indian Council of Agricultural Research (ICAR), New Delhi since April 11, 2005 and superannuated on December 31, 2008. Dr. Ali received his B. Sc. (Agril. Engg) from Allahabad Agricultural Institute, Allahabad in 1968 and both M. Tech and PhD degrees from IIT, Kharagpur in 1970 and 1975 respectively. He started his career at IIT, Kharagpur in 1974. After serving IIT for about 4.7 years, he joined the Central Institute of Agricultural Engineering (CIAE), Bhopal in October 1978 and later on he served CIAE as the Head of Post Harvest Engineering Division and Project Coordinator of the All India Coordinated Research Project on Post-Harvest Technology. In November 1986, Dr. Ali was appointed as the Project Director of Soybean Processing & Utilization (SPU) Project at CIAE, Bhopal. Dr. Ali also worked as Director Incharge of the Central Institute of Post-Harvest Engineering and Technology, Ludhiana (1989-91) and the Indian Lac Research Institute, Ranchi (1993). Dr. Ali served as the Director, CIAE, Bhopal during November 11, 2002 to 10th April, 2005. Dr. Ali was awarded the Jawaharlal Nehru Award of ICAR for an outstanding Post-Graduate Research in Agriculture in 1977 and the Commendation Medals of India Society of Agricultural Engineers in 1985 and 1998 for his significant contribution in Post Harvest Engineering and distinguished services to the Society. He was also awarded the ISAE Gold Medal in 2002. Dr. Ali served the ISAE as its President during 2006-08. He is a Fellow of ISAE. He is also a life member of Association of Food Scientists and Technologists (India) and the Nutritional Society of India.
